Understanding the principle of normalization in data management

Normalization is key to streamlining data in databases. It reduces redundancy and improves data integrity by organizing information efficiently. When you structure your data well, you not only save space but also enhance accuracy. Curious to know how it all connects?

The Art of Normalization: Making Sense of Data

When you think about data, what pops into your mind? A jumble of numbers and text? A complex web of relationships? For many, it may seem overwhelming at first. But here’s the good news: understanding how to organize and manage that data can simplify everything. One key principle that plays a crucial role in data management is normalization. So, what does normalization aim to achieve in the grand scheme of data organization? Grab your data cap and let’s take this enlightening journey together!

The Core of Normalization

Simply put, normalization is about reducing redundancy and improving data integrity. Think of it this way: when you have a messy room cluttered with items all over, it’s hard to find what you need, leading to chaos. But once you organize everything—putting similar items together and discarding duplicates—you can move freely and locate items with ease. That’s the essence of normalization in data management.

In database systems, normalization establishes relationships between different pieces of data while ensuring each piece is stored only once. The principle is about organizing existing data efficiently—not increasing the volume of data, mind you. By structuring data into smaller, related tables, it becomes simpler to retrieve, update, and manage, while significantly improving its integrity. No more errantly changing one piece of information in multiple locations!

What Happens When We Don’t Normalize?

Consider this: you went to a restaurant and fell in love with the chef’s special burger. You remember telling your friends about it, and they, in turn, tell their friends. Now imagine if each of those conversations was recorded in multiple places. If the chef changes the recipe, updating every single conversation becomes a chaotic nightmare! You might end up with different versions of the chef's special that can lead to confusion—much like an unnormalized database can lead to inconsistent data.

In the realm of data management, the need to update details can arise frequently. With normalization, when changes are necessary, they happen smoothly in one location—like turning a sticky doorknob back to its perfect state from a single point. Fewer duplicates mean less risk of inconsistency. The attention to data integrity decreases the likelihood of varied or wrong information perpetuating through the system.

Other Applications of Normalization

While the heartbeat of normalization is around reducing duplication and improving data integrity, one may wonder whether it offers other benefits as well. Interestingly, while improved speed of data access isn't the main goal, it can be a vibrant byproduct of a well-normalized database. Imagine a library where every book is categorized accurately. It’s easier to find what you need quickly! Just like that, normalization can streamline data retrieval and improve efficiency.

However, increasing the volume of data is where normalization takes a backseat. You see, normalization focuses on the relationships between data points and structures them efficiently, but it doesn’t concern itself with making more data. Greater data volume typically arises from other activities, such as data generation or collection—not normalization.

The Visualization Factor

And let’s not forget about the allure of data visualization. With beautiful charts and eye-catching graphics in play today, it’s easy to think this relates to how we organize our data. But here’s the thing: data visualization is really about presentation—how data looks to users and analysts—and isn’t inherently tied to the principle of normalization. In fact, for visualizations to be accurate, the integrity of the underlying data is crucial, and here’s where normalization shines bright!

Wrapping Up

In a world overflowing with data, understanding how to manage it effectively is more important than ever. Normalization may seem like a technical term reserved for database experts, but its impact reaches far and wide. It’s not just about “cleaning up” dusty data; it’s about enhancing confidence in that data’s accuracy and reliability. Who wouldn’t want cleaner insights?

As you explore the vast landscape of data analytics, remember that normalization is the bedrock upon which efficient and reliable data practices are built. So, the next time you’re knee-deep in numbers or organizing database queries, think of normalization—not as a chore—but as a pathway to clarity and consistency. Why settle for chaos when a little structure can go a long way? Happy data diving!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y